Human trafficking ring leader taken into custody

»  Comments | Post a Comment

GREENVILLE, N.C. - The ring leader in a human trafficking organization has been arrested.

That's according to the Pitt County Sheriff's Office.

37-year-old Oscar Salinas-Rodriguez was taken into custody Thursday at a brothel house on Highway 264 East in Greenville.

Deputies say the prostitution operation is part of a larger criminal organization.

A female victim from western North Carolina was identified and rescued. She was allegedly promised a cleaning job, but when she arrived, she was forced to engage in sex labor. She had been held at the brothel for about a week.

46-year-old Kenia Susana Valdez-Gomez of Brooklyn, NY and 20-year-old Jose Machado Castro of Wilson were also arrested and charged with Solicit for Prostitution. 

Valdez-Gomez and Castro were both placed in the Pitt County Detention Center under a $5,000 secured bond. 

Salinas-Rodriguez is also charged with Sexual Servitude Adult Victim and also placed in the Pitt County Detention Center under a $100,000 secured bond, as well as an immigration detainer.

 Multiple agencies took part in the operation.
